Recipe: Oats & Whole Wheat Mathri

Ingredients:

  • Wheat flour: 1 cup
  • Oats (ground): ½ cup
  • Semolina: ¼ cup
  • Celery: 1 tsp
  • Kasuri Methi: 1 tablespoon (crushed with hands)
  • Salt: as per taste
  • Oil/Ghee (for moyan): ¼ cup (heated)
  • Water: to knead the dough
  • Oil: for frying

How to make (Instructions):

  1. Prepare the dough: In a large bowl, add wheat flour, ground oats, semolina, celery, kasuri methi and salt and mix well.
  2. Enter Moyan: Now add hot oil or ghee (for kneading) into it and mix the dough well with your fingers, so that the oil/ghee gets mixed well in the entire dough and the dough starts forming a fist. It makes matari crispy.
  3. Knead the dough: Knead a hard and soft dough by gradually adding water. The dough should not be too wet. Cover the dough and keep it aside for 15-20 minutes so that it sets.
  4. Make matari: Make small balls from the dough. Flatten them a bit by pressing them with your palms or roll them lightly and give them the shape of peas. Do not keep the peas too thick or thin. Make a few holes in each pea with a fork, so that it does not swell while frying and becomes crispy.
  5. Fry: Heat oil in a pan on medium flame. When the oil is hot, fry the peas on low to medium flame until they turn golden brown. Fry them well from both the sides so that they become crispy from inside.
  6. Remove: Take out the fried peas and keep them on tissue paper to remove excess oil.

Serving Method:
Serve hot crispy matris with mint chutney, coriander chutney, tamarind chutney or any dip sauce of your choice. You can also give it as a snack with tea.
